How Do Agents Pay for Services?
Agents pay through machine rails — x402, AP2, AgentKit, and plain API credits — not human checkout flows. The rails are settled; the gate is the open question.
The rails
x402: HTTP-based agent payments.
AP2: the agent-pay protocol for agentic commerce.
AgentKit: Coinbase's agent payment framework.
API credits: the default — per-token or per-call billing.
Who decides
The rail executes; the firewall decides.
Deterministic rules in front of the rail: APPROVED, BLOCKED, FLAGGED.
FAQ
Do agents have credit cards?
Not typically — they use rails and API credits. Cards are the human layer.
What stops an agent from paying anything?
The merchant allowlist — unapproved vendors are simply not payable.
